Speaker Details by Location
Location Size Type Notes
Front Door Panel 5.25 Midbass / Full-Range
  • Standard installation
  • High replacement priority
  • Replacement difficulty: low
Rear Door Panel 6.75 Midbass / Full-Range
  • Standard installation
  • Medium replacement priority
  • Replacement difficulty: low

2003 GMC Yukon Radio Slot Size (DIN)

DIN Type Size (inch) Size (mm) Notes
Single DIN or Double DIN 7"×2" or 7"×4" 180×50 or 180×100 Vehicle supports both radio sizes
  • Always measure the slot before purchasing a new radio
  • Check slot depth - it may vary

Additional Notes

  • The front door panels in the 2003 GMC Yukon accept 5.25 inch speakers that can function as either midbass drivers or full-range units, suggesting that replacement options may prioritize frequency range based on whether the factory system includes separate tweeters.
  • Rear door panels accommodate larger 6.75 inch speakers compared to the front positions, which could provide enhanced low-frequency output in the rear soundstage when replacing factory components.
  • Both front and rear positions support midbass or full-range speaker types, indicating flexibility in system configuration depending on whether component or coaxial speakers are selected for installation.
  • The size differential between front and rear speakers in the 2003 GMC Yukon may require attention to sensitivity and power handling specifications when upgrading to maintain balanced output across all door positions.
  • Aftermarket head units may be installed using either single DIN or double DIN configurations, potentially allowing for source upgrades that better match the capabilities of replacement speakers.
  • The 6.75 inch rear speaker size represents a less common format that may limit aftermarket options compared to standard 6.5 inch alternatives, though adapter brackets or spacers might accommodate near-equivalent sizes.
